Dental care can be one of the most crucial needs in medical care, however, if it’s affordable, your needs can be met. Once you give up dental care, you may develop more severe health problems.

In addition to the likelihood of losing teeth, it can also affect your heart, brain, and immune system.

According to the American Dental Association (ADA), a gum disease that triggers tooth loss (called periodontitis) is related to other more serious conditions, such as bacterial pneumonia, stroke, and cardiovascular condition. Other studies indicate that an unhealthy mouth can be associated with diabetes.

Without proper dental care, small cavities or painful teeth can cause more serious complications than cavities. You shouldn’t delay making an appointment.

How low cost dental plans differ from standard insurance plan:
Instant Savings: Once you are on a subscription plan, you get a 10% to 60% off. You pay the dental professional instantly for their services, and there are no hidden charges.

For example, you need a process that commonly costs $300. As a part of the discount plan, you are qualified to receive a 60% discount on this treatment.

Hence, you will only spend $ 120 to get your dental care fixed ($ 300 – 60% = $ 120). No extra service fees will be placed. This subsidized rate allows you to immediately obtain affordable dental care.

No paperwork troubles: With traditional insurance, there is a long waiting period that you need to undergo while the insurance firm determines whether or not you qualify for coverage. This is known as the underwriting period.

There’s no long underwriting period with a reduction plan. Your membership becomes active within three business days from the time you join the discount network. If you want a cover for your loved ones, they will be covered at the same time as you.

No monthly bills: There are no monthly installments to pay for. Once you have signed up for your discount plan, you’ll be covered for a throughout the year.

No deductions: There’s no deductible to pay before your benefits are applied. When you are a member of the network, you’re fully qualified to receive member savings. The dental professionals give their dental services to members at a drastically lower rate.

All dental professionals in the dental network are licensed by the board in their area of specialty. Membership coverage includes emergency procedures and preventative including cleanings, root canals, fillings, bridges, crowns, orthodontics, extractions, X-rays and more. Getting cosmetic dentistry and dental care in various areas Fruitvale Idaho and anywhere in the world, especially in developed nations can be too expensive regardless of having access to some type of dental insurance coverage.

In a survey (1999-2004), the National Health and Nutrition Examination Survey (NHANES) found out that 3.75% of adults aged 20 to 64 didn’t have teeth remaining. In 2010, virtually 45 million Americans didn’t have dental coverage, based on statistics from the US federal agency CDC.

Many individuals with a regular earnings and without insurance coverage avoid their dentist appointments due to the high prices associated with pain.

Nonetheless, delaying the necessary dental care or control may expose them to more expensive and longer-term dental procedures. It is understandable that oral and dental issues can aggravate a person’s oral health if not treated quickly.

If you need dental treatment or surgery, but are skeptical because of the high dentist’s charge, following helpful suggestions can save you funds on your dental treatment.

Here are helpful suggestions for minimizing the cost of dental treatment for the insured and the uninsured.

Stay away from frequent X-rays: Your dentist may suggest a dental x-ray on your initial visit, a scheduled check-up, or a return for treatment.

But the American Dental Association (ADA) advises that the frequency of visits to the dentist’s X-ray chair be based upon the current state of the patient’s oral health.

Hence, if you have good oral health, you simply don’t need tooth x-rays at every appointment to the dentist.

If you take an X-ray with your teeth less often, you can’t only save big money, but it will also prevent you from being in contact with potentially harmful X-rays.

Use negotiation: One other way to minimize the cost of your dental care is to talk to your dentist regarding payment methods during the initial consultation.

After having a clear idea of what will or will not be included in the dentist’s bill, you can claim a discount on the dental fees.

Your medical provider and dental center can give you various payment choices. Do not be hesitant to pay your dental expenses every month or quarterly.

Exchange: It may sound ridiculous, but you can get free dentistry through the barter system. Individuals with various professional capabilities and services, like carpentry or web page design, can modify their dental care services.

For instance, you can develop a website for your dental professional or offer plumbing, mechanics or other facility in return for the price of dental treatment.

Looking for Dentistry at a School of Dentistry: To increase the size of your dental savings, take into account getting your dental care at a dental institution, where dental treatments will be performed by students under the supervision of licensed dental professionals at a portion of what you’d pay in the clinic of a private dental professional.

Brush and floss daily: More significantly, if you want to save some money, you should take good care of your oral health.

Remember to brush your teeth twice daily or after mealtime and floss at least one time a day in order to avoid the chance of oral issues. Lower your sugar intake to reduce your dental issues.

Dental tips for healthy teeth

Dental care is essential for healthy teeth. This element of dental health is vital as it contributes considerably to the general well-being.

Although regular consultation with a dental expert is a great approach to get the info you need about proper dental care, minor changes to your diet and oral care routine can reduce your time spent at the dentist.

By practicing proper dental care, you’ll avoid bad breath, gum illness, enhance your general health, and save cash on costly dental treatments. Here are some tips on dental care that, if followed, will help you maintain healthy teeth that can last a lifetime.

Floss and brush

Clean and healthy teeth are the beginning of dental health. Regular use of dental floss and brushing is really important to keep your teeth and gums healthy and healthy. Remember to brush your teeth twice a day with a fluoride toothpaste that helps avoid cavities.

Don’t be in a rush. Rather, spend some time to brush your teeth. Be sure to use a toothbrush that matches the structure of your mouth and the position of your teeth.

Your toothbrush should be soft and well rounded. Additionally, clean the tongue to avoid smelly breath and be sure to replace your brush every two months.

Daily dental flossing is also vital. Flossing helps you reach the firm spaces between your teeth and below the gum line. Rub the sides of your teeth gently with floss and do not skimp.

If you have trouble flossing between your teeth, try using waxed dental floss. Be as careful as you can when flossing to avoid hurting your gums. Also, take into consideration providing dental prostheses as real teeth in your dental habits.

Watch your diet

Stay away from sugary foods because too much-refined sugar boosts the growth of the plaque. Be sure you consume and eat healthier foods, like low-fat milk products, whole wheat, and green vegetables.

Drink plenty of water to stay hydrated. Avoid soft drinks such as soda and caffeine, as they can dehydrate you and harm teeth.

Don’t use tobacco products because they cause gum disease and oral cancer. It must be kept in mind that eating healthy should be part of your daily routine and is as necessary as flossing and brushing your teeth.

Regular dental appointments

It is essential to make annual appointments with your dentist, regardless of the strength of your teeth. Do not forget to check your mouth between dental consultations.

If chips, lumps, unusual changes, or red bumps are seen in the mouth, ask a dentist right away. With this routine, you can save lots of money on gum and tooth ailments.

Your dentist will provide detailed treatments that will ensure a cleaner and healthy mouth. Go to the dentist depending on how often you need cleaning and check-up.
